item_rule.d.ts 500 B

1234567891011121314
  1. import { AbstractEntry } from './abstract_entry.js';
  2. import { Menu } from './menu.js';
  3. import { ParserFactory } from './parser_factory.js';
  4. export declare class Rule extends AbstractEntry {
  5. protected className: import("./html_classes.js").HtmlClass;
  6. protected role: string;
  7. static fromJson(_factory: ParserFactory, {}: {}, menu: Menu): Rule;
  8. constructor(menu: Menu);
  9. generateHtml(): void;
  10. addEvents(_element: HTMLElement): void;
  11. toJson(): {
  12. type: string;
  13. };
  14. }